Reports Say that At Least Seven NBA Teams Interested in Getting Jeremy Lin

Looking for his home team

Lin has been saying after the regular season ended last month and saw the Lakers logging in one of the most forgetful seasons in the checkered history of the franchise that he wants to finally find a home team, after being in four NBA teams in his five years in the NBA.

During the 2014-15 NBA season, Lin averaged 11.1 points and 4.6 assists per game, which is not bad at all. While he was groping for form for most of the early part of the past season as he was looking to fit with the Lakers and the dominating presence of Kobe Bryant, it was after the All-Star break that saw Lin playing more aggressive basketball and becoming a valuable option in the point for the team.

Although he was not a kind of go-to-guy that the Lakers needed when the chips were down, Jeremy Lin was a role player no less and can deliver the goods when called upon to do so. But with the absence of its prolific star player, the Lakers were playing like headless chickens during the most part of the NBA 2014-15 regular season.

Lin may not have found a fit in the Laker’s Princeton-based offense, but he could be pivotal in a team that thrives in a running offense that features more pick-and-roll and fastbreak plays.
